Fan-out pushes alerts from the ingest topic to regional subscriber queues. Dedup window is 10 minutes, keyed on alert hash — don't shorten it, duplicates spike during storm clusters. Known issue: the coastal region queue occasionally lags under burst load; mitigation is bumping its partition count, documented in the runbook. Retry policy is three attempts then dead-letter; the DLQ drains manually. Schema changes require a version bump on both producer and consumer. Long-term ownership sits with the engineer named below.

account owner for bawip-tahag: Raleth Quenok

Handover note — Crumbwheel order cutoffs.

Welcome aboard. The bakery cutoff rule in Crumbwheel closes same-day orders at 14:00 local to each storefront, not UTC — this has bitten us twice. Holiday overrides live in the calendar service and take precedence silently, so always check there first when a cutoff looks wrong. To unlock the calendar service's admin console after a restart, enter the recovery passphrase below.

vault phrase of bagap-bahaf = silion-pelox-sorox-casdor-quenwyn-fraax-eliox-praael-kelion-quenvan-kasox-rusael-norius-belvan

# Break-Glass: Catalog Cache Invalidation

Scope: the Pinrow product catalog at Veldstone Retail. If stale prices persist after a purge and the Hollowmere invalidation queue is wedged, use break-glass to flush the edge tier directly. Contractors: get verbal sign-off from the catalog lead first. Steps: open the Hollowmere admin shell, select emergency-flush, confirm the tenant, and run it once — repeated flushes thrash the origin. Access is logged and expires after 20 minutes. Unseal the admin shell with the passphrase below.

recovery phrase for kahop-tajog: istix-casvan

## Deployment

The Quillbranch assignment service must be deployed one region at a time, starting with the canary pool in the Velthorn cluster. Verify that experiment bucketing stays deterministic by replaying the golden traffic set before promoting. If assignment skew exceeds 0.5% between old and new pods, roll back immediately and page the experimentation lead. Never deploy during an active holdout freeze. Before starting, confirm your environment matches the expected configuration, which is reproduced below for convenience.

deployment values, kajep-kageg:
[praix]
host = praix.paliqcorp.corp
user = praix_svc
database = praix_prod